117.info
人生若只如初见

vb类型不匹配如何解决

当VB类型不匹配时,可以使用以下方法解决:

  1. 强制类型转换:如果你确定两个类型可以相互转换,可以使用类型转换函数(如CInt、CStr等)进行强制类型转换。

  2. 使用显式类型转换:如果两个类型之间没有直接的转换函数,可以使用显式类型转换(如CType)来将一个类型转换为另一个类型。

  3. 修改变量类型:如果两个类型无法转换,可以考虑修改变量的类型,使其与另一个类型匹配。

  4. 使用适当的运算符:根据需要的操作,选择适当的运算符来处理不匹配的类型。例如,使用&运算符将不同类型的变量连接为字符串。

  5. 使用条件语句:在处理不匹配的类型时,可以使用条件语句(如If语句)来根据不同的类型执行不同的操作。

  6. 使用函数或方法进行类型转换:如果需要频繁进行类型转换,可以将类型转换的逻辑封装到一个函数或方法中,以便重复使用。

  7. 检查变量的值和范围:有时,类型不匹配可能是因为变量的值或范围出现问题。确保变量的值和范围正确,避免类型不匹配的问题。

总之,解决VB类型不匹配的关键是了解类型转换的方法和技巧,并根据具体情况选择合适的解决方法。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ea5bAzsLBwNSBVw.html

推荐文章

  • vb中如何把字符串转化成日期

    在VB中,可以使用Date.Parse或Date.TryParse方法将字符串转换为日期。
    Dim dateString As String = "2021-09-30"
    Dim dateValue As Date = Date.Parse...

  • vb中包含函数如何使用

    在 VB 中使用函数的步骤如下: 首先,你需要声明函数的名称、参数和返回值类型。在 VB 中,可以使用 Function 关键字来声明函数。例如:Function MyFunction(par...

  • VB中FormatDateTime函数的用法是什么

    FormatDateTime函数是用来格式化日期和时间的函数。它的用法如下:
    FormatDateTime(date, format)
    其中,date是要格式化的日期或时间,可以是Date类型...

  • vb中msgbox函数如何使用

    在VB中,MsgBox函数用于显示一个简单的消息框,可以用于显示一些提示信息给用户。
    MsgBox函数的基本语法如下:
    MsgBox(prompt[, buttons] [,title] [,...

  • vb参数不可选问题怎么解决

    在VB中,可以使用Optional关键字来指定参数是否可选。
    如果希望一个参数是可选的,可以将其声明为Optional类型,如下所示:
    Sub MySub(Optional ByVal...

  • vb中function函数怎么调用

    在VB中,可以通过以下步骤来调用一个函数: 首先,确保函数已经被定义。函数应该在Sub或Function语句块内部定义,例如: Function MyFunction() As Integer

  • AJAX中XMLHttpRequest对象怎么使用

    在AJAX中,XMLHttpRequest对象的使用如下: 创建一个XMLHttpRequest对象: var xhr = new XMLHttpRequest(); 设置请求的方法和URL: xhr.open('GET', 'example.c...

  • 云服务器防火墙在哪里设置

    云服务器防火墙可以在多个地方进行设置,具体取决于你使用的云平台和操作系统。一般来说,以下是一些常见的设置位置: 云平台控制台:对于大多数云平台,你可以登...